From a22768cc1e1239f0eb361bf8b6409c925dfcf156 Mon Sep 17 00:00:00 2001 From: Andrew Sapperstein Date: Thu, 6 Jul 2017 16:34:58 -0700 Subject: [PATCH] Search bar polish Updated main page text color, text size, and search bar height. Also updated results page text size. Change-Id: Ic4a390136b854741a73e99431b8dd9452871dd2c Fixes: 63397599 Fixes: 63394285 Test: robotests and manual --- res/layout/search_panel.xml | 2 +- res/layout/settings_main_dashboard.xml | 5 +++-- res/values-sw600dp/dimens.xml | 2 ++ res/values/dimens.xml | 3 +++ res/values/styles.xml | 4 ++++ src/com/android/settings/search/SearchFragment.java | 7 ++++++- 6 files changed, 19 insertions(+), 4 deletions(-) diff --git a/res/layout/search_panel.xml b/res/layout/search_panel.xml index 7461374444b..0a3d952bed5 100644 --- a/res/layout/search_panel.xml +++ b/res/layout/search_panel.xml @@ -36,7 +36,7 @@ diff --git a/res/values-sw600dp/dimens.xml b/res/values-sw600dp/dimens.xml index 0157fa23926..041191467fe 100755 --- a/res/values-sw600dp/dimens.xml +++ b/res/values-sw600dp/dimens.xml @@ -66,6 +66,8 @@ 24dp 32dp + 64dp + 24dp 24dp diff --git a/res/values/dimens.xml b/res/values/dimens.xml index 1af83956be2..70417e5c3ca 100755 --- a/res/values/dimens.xml +++ b/res/values/dimens.xml @@ -145,6 +145,9 @@ 8dp -8dp + 48dp + 16dp + 16dp 16dp diff --git a/res/values/styles.xml b/res/values/styles.xml index 398bdbd1544..35810efdef8 100644 --- a/res/values/styles.xml +++ b/res/values/styles.xml @@ -458,4 +458,8 @@ @color/material_grey_300 + + diff --git a/src/com/android/settings/search/SearchFragment.java b/src/com/android/settings/search/SearchFragment.java index aec140aeb15..7ceec621fa7 100644 --- a/src/com/android/settings/search/SearchFragment.java +++ b/src/com/android/settings/search/SearchFragment.java @@ -30,6 +30,7 @@ import android.support.v7.widget.RecyclerView; import android.text.TextUtils; import android.util.Log; import android.util.Pair; +import android.util.TypedValue; import android.view.LayoutInflater; import android.view.View; import android.view.ViewGroup; @@ -187,8 +188,12 @@ public class SearchFragment extends InstrumentedFragment implements SearchView.O // check. This ensures if we return, say, a LinearLayout in the tests, they won't fail. View searchText = mSearchView.findViewById(com.android.internal.R.id.search_src_text); if (searchText instanceof TextView) { - ((TextView) searchText).setTextColor(getContext().getColorStateList( + TextView searchTextView = (TextView) searchText; + searchTextView.setTextColor(getContext().getColorStateList( com.android.internal.R.color.text_color_primary)); + searchTextView.setTextSize(TypedValue.COMPLEX_UNIT_PX, + getResources().getDimension(R.dimen.search_bar_text_size)); + } View editFrame = mSearchView.findViewById(com.android.internal.R.id.search_edit_frame); if (editFrame != null) {